1. Daily Spin and Pick’em Rewards

The simplest way to start stacking VC every single day is through Daily Rewards and Daily Pick’em.

· Daily Spin: Visit the prize wheel in The City and spin it once every day. You can win anywhere from 500 to 25,000 VC instantly, along with useful boosts that save you VC on purchases.

· Daily Pick’em: When the NBA season starts, head to the Pick’em area and guess the winners of real-life NBA games. Each correct prediction gives you bonus VC-completely free.

These are quick, effortless ways to build up your VC over time. Never skip them; consistency pays off.


2. Join a Crew for VC Bonuses

If you aren’t in a crew yet, you’re missing out on big multipliers. Joining a crew provides a VC boost for every game you play in the park:

· Level 7 Crew = +5% VC

· Level 13 Crew = +10% VC

· Level 20 Crew = +25% VC

· Level 25+ Crew = +50% VC

That means instead of earning 700 VC per game, you could be earning over 1,000. Play with active members who complete weekly goals (like winning a certain number of games) to score additional VC bonuses for the whole team.


3. Streak Hunting in the Park

This is the fastest way to make huge VC if you’re skilled at the game. When you load into The City, look for courts where teams are on long win streaks.

· Beating a 10-game streak can earn around 5,000 VC.

· Taking down a 20-game streak can net 10,000–20,000 VC in minutes.

Switch servers until you find streaks worth targeting. It’s competitive, but if you can win consistently, streak hunting beats any other VC method.


4. Complete Challenges and Grind Rep

Challenges and reputation rewards provide steady VC throughout the season.

· Lifetime Challenges: Completing all 250 can earn up to 500,000 VC.

· Daily Challenges: Typically pay 500–2,500 VC for completing simple tasks.

· Season Challenges: Reward VC for milestones like playing 200 park games or scoring 5,000 points.

· Rep Rewards: As your rep increases, especially from Veteran 4 upward, you’ll earn massive VC bonuses-sometimes over 100,000 VC for hitting new ranks.

Focus on these objectives during normal gameplay, and you’ll constantly add to your VC pool without extra effort.


5. Beat the Park MVP

Every City has a Park MVP, the highest-ranked player in your park. If you manage to beat them, you’ll earn 5x your usual VC payout.
For example, if you normally earn 700 VC per game, that win jumps to over 3,500 VC. On top of that, you gain valuable rep and bragging rights. Keep an eye out for the MVP’s court and challenge them whenever possible.


6. Play Stage Games (High-Risk, High-Reward)

The Stage is where players bet VC to compete for bigger rewards. It’s risky, but the payout is real:

· 1v1 Court = 1,000 VC buy-in

· 2v2 Court = 2,500 VC

· 3v3 Court = 5,000–10,000 VC

If you’re confident in your skills, Stage is the most direct way to multiply your VC quickly. Stick to the 2.5K or 1K courts for safer profits while you build confidence.


7. Complete MyCareer Quests

Quests in MyCareer are an underrated source of VC. Some examples include:

· “Use the Menu in the TV Room” = 2,500 VC

· “Win One Training Game” = 500 VC

· “Play 30 Open Court Games” = 2,500 VC

Go through your quest log regularly-many missions take minutes to finish and reward generous VC. Combine this with your daily and lifetime challenges for a steady income stream.


8. The High School “Out of Bounds” Trick

Here’s the secret method most players overlook. When creating a new build, choose to start your MyCareer but opt for “Out of Bounds” instead of the NBA Draft. This places you in high school games that pay around 1,000 VC each.
Each match takes about five minutes-hit a few shots, foul out, and repeat. You can remake builds and farm these high school games for easy VC, especially early on. Completing the full “Out of Bounds” questline nets an extra 2,500 VC bonus.
